I have always managed to get a much earlier EuroTunnel crossing with no charge.

I have even in the past booked a cheaper later crossing and ignored it and went earlier.

At the self checkin at Folkestone, you just enter your booking ref, then it asks you if you would like to go earlier and shows the next possible one.
 

If you're in any doubt about being able to get an earlier crossing, I'd change you Princess meal booking to a lunch during the week. Its the same meal, and the same character interaction.

We too have had luck getting an earlier crossing by checking in early. Plus several times we have had luck getting on the shuttle before the one we were booked on by driving through to the boarding area as soon as our letter was called. If you are quick enough you are often there before the previous shuttle has finished loading and if there is room they send you straight on.
